Basseterre, St. Kitts, Monday 1st February 2016 – The Board of Directors is pleased to announce the appointment of Mr. Denzil James as the new Chief Executive Officer of the St. Christopher Air and Sea Ports Authority (SCASPA) with effect from Monday February 1st 2016.
Mr. James brings significant experience and expertise to his new role at SCASPA. For the past twenty-five years he was employed by the Eastern Caribbean Central Bank (ECCB) where he held various positions.
Mr. James most recent position was Advisor to the Governor immediate Office. Prior to joining ECCB, Mr. James served as a Graduate Teacher (Head of the Business Division) at the Cayon High School.
Mr. James holds a Master’s of Science in Finance and Accounting and a Bachelor’s of Science in Economics and Accounting.
The Board of Directors and Management wish Mr. James every success as he takes up his new role as SCASPA’s Chief Executive Officer.
